Greetings! Does anyone have a good insurance contact in Nevada and what do you pay for insurance on your SEEG. State Farm is wanting over a grand a year in Nevada. I pay 400.00 a year on my CVO Deuce. Any help would be greatly appreciated!

Try Foremost - I had Progressive for many years, until they decided to double my rates (no claims, no violations, no nothing).  Foremost came in at half of Progressive for the same coverage.  Check out the web site, but I suggest you actually call for an estimate.  The web site estimate uses each states minimum requirements for default coverage, and that won't be close to what you need.

The best part is that the standard coverage is much better than what I had with Progressive also, such as $3500 coverage for accessories, $1500 coverage for damage to safety apparel, replacement cost coverage for first 2 years.
